Fingers of Printing Worker Are Amputated by Cutting Machine

On December 30, 2009, Employee #1, working at a commercial printing company, reached into an unguarded edge trimmer on a paper indexing machine, (Index Cutter, Class B). Three fingers from her right hand were amputated. The guard had been removed by a supervisor the day before the accident so that the machine could be set-up and adjusted for a production run.
